Torque and Power

The Avrhit 1300N.m boasts a slightly higher torque rating of 1300N.m (960ft-lbs) compared to Zekkip's 958ft-lbs (1300N.m). While the difference in torque may seem minor, it indicates that the Avrhit is specifically engineered for tougher jobs requiring a bit more power. Conversely, the Zekkip provides a robust loosening torque of 1500N.m, making it efficient for both tightening and loosening tasks. Users needing peak torque for heavy-duty applications may lean towards the Avrhit, while those focused on versatility may appreciate Zekkip's performance.

Motor Efficiency

The Avrhit features an efficient brushless motor with three-speed settings, allowing speeds up to 2200RPM. This design not only enhances longevity but also operates at lower noise levels. The Zekkip, however, takes it a step further with a brushless motor that can reach up to 3500RPM, providing a significant increase in speed for quicker job completion. The choice between these motors depends on whether speed or efficiency is more crucial to the user’s tasks.

Battery Life and Charging

Both impact wrenches come with two 4000mAh batteries, providing ample power for extended use. However, the Zekkip claims a 50% longer run time compared to other electric wrenches, which may appeal to users who require long operational periods without interruptions. The Avrhit also emphasizes its battery life, stating that it offers over 70.5% more battery life than standard 2.0Ah packs. While both models promise substantial battery performance, Zekkip’s claim of longer usage could be a decisive factor for professional applications.

Control Features

The Avrhit includes a two-way brake stop feature that enhances control during use, preventing nuts and bolts from flying off after loosening. The Zekkip, on the other hand, offers multiple modes, including three forward speed modes and two reverse modes, allowing for precise control of the fastening process. Users who value versatility might prefer the Zekkip’s varied speed settings, while those focused on safety and control might find the Avrhit's brake stop feature preferable.

Additional Accessories

The Zekkip comes with a comprehensive package that includes five impact sockets and a tool case, enhancing its value for users who need a complete set for various tasks. The Avrhit, while not offering as many accessories, still provides a solid impact wrench and the essential two batteries and a fast charger. For buyers looking for a more complete toolkit, the Zekkip clearly stands out with its additional components, potentially offering more bang for the buck.
